What Is Augnito?
Augnito is an AI‑driven clinical documentation platform built to transform how health professionals capture patient records. It uses ambient voice AI and intelligent templates to convert natural speech into structured clinical documentation with high accuracy, reducing administrative workload and improving patient engagement.
Additionally, it helps clinicians maintain compliance by leveraging an automated code-retrieval service, thereby reducing denials and optimizing revenue cycles. What makes it stand out is its CDI service, which improves document accountability by supporting coding compliance and clinical indicators.
How Much Does Augnito Cost?
Augnito cost falls between $50 and $200/user/month, according to industry benchmarks for similar EMR speech-to-text and clinical documentation solutions. This range is intended for general budgeting purposes, as actual costs can differ based on the number of users, EMR integrations, and specific module selections.
In addition to the base subscription costs, organizations should account for the following expenses:
- Implementation: $1,000–$10,000 for SMBs; $10,000–$50,000 for large hospitals or complex deployments
- Data Migration And Setup: $1,000–$8,000, based on the volume of legacy clinical records and documentation formats
- Staff Training: $1,000–$6,000, depending on the number of clinicians and depth of training
- API/EMR Integrations: $2,000–$15,000, depending on the number and complexity of EMR systems connected
- Support And SLA Upgrades: Optional enterprise-level support can add recurring costs beyond the base subscription
Disclaimer: Pricing references are based on publicly available third-party information and industry benchmarks. Actual costs may vary.

Augnito Features
Voice-Driven Clinical Documentation
Augnito Spectra utilizes specialized speech recognition to convert medical dictation into text with 99% accuracy by leveraging custom vocabulary to optimize details. It supports pre-defined templates that enable clinicians to enter data more quickly, fostering better patient interactions.
Omni AI Scribe
Augnito features an ambient scribe service that uses natural language processing to listen to clinician-patient interactions and automatically structure them into comprehensive clinical notes. This personalization even allows doctors to transfer data into existing EMRs for immediate access to client records.
Omni AI Coder
The AI coder streamlines the billing process by automatically extracting relevant ICD-10 and SNOMED codes from the clinical text. This automatic code retrieval tool ensures that documentation is correctly coded at the source, reducing claim denials and facilitating smoother clinical billing and analytics workflows.
Clinical Documentation Integrity Omni CDI Agent
This agent provides real-time suggestions and quality checks to ensure that medical records meet compliance and safety standards, bolstering documentation integrity. By identifying missing information and unambiguous terminology, it ensures that patient records are accurate and insurance-ready, supporting optimal care outcomes.

Frequently Asked Questions
Does Augnito have a mobile app?
Yes, Augnito offers the "Augnito Omni" and "Augnito: Medical Dictation" apps for both iOS and Android devices.
What level of support does Augnito offer?
Augnito offers 24/7 technical assistance via email and phone calls.
What language does Augnito support?
Augnito is primarily available in English, supporting over 37 dialects and accents, including Indian, British, and American English.

Does Augnito offer an API?
Yes, Augnito provides a robust API and SDK through its developer portal for integrating voice AI into RIS, PACS, and EMR systems.
